Many a creative advertising agency has launched a brand development strategy that struck resonant chords in consumers and consequently became part of the pop culture fabric. People still nostalgically say “Where’s the beef?” or “Hey kid, catch!” In order for a brand development strategy to stick, a top creative agency has to take risks. Here …